CC   -!- FUNCTION: Calcium-independent, phospholipid- and diacylglycerol (DAG)-
CC       dependent serine/threonine-protein kinase that plays contrasting roles
CC       in cell death and cell survival by functioning as a pro-apoptotic
CC       protein during DNA damage-induced apoptosis, but acting as an anti-
CC       apoptotic protein during cytokine receptor-initiated cell death, is
CC       involved in tumor suppression. {ECO:0000256|PIRNR:PIRNR000551}.

CC   -!- ACTIVITY REGULATION: Novel PKCs (PRKCD, PRKCE, PRKCH and PRKCQ) are
CC       calcium-insensitive, but activated by diacylglycerol (DAG) and
CC       phosphatidylserine. {ECO:0000256|PIRNR:PIRNR000551}.
CC   -!- SUBUNIT: Interacts with PDPK1 (via N-terminal region), RAD9A, CDCP1,
CC       MUC1 and VASP. {ECO:0000256|PIRNR:PIRNR000551}.
